Participation Criteria
Eligibility Criteria
Ages Eligible for Study
Accepts Healthy Volunteers
Description
Inclusion Criteria:
- Subjects 18-65 years of age
- Acne scars on the face
- Able and willing to comply with all study procedures and at home care; and,
- Able and willing to give informed consent.
Exclusion Criteria:
- Hypersensitive to light in the near infrared wavelength region
- On medication known to increase sensitivity to sunlight
- Seizure disorder triggered by light
- Takes or has taken oral isotretinoin, such as Accutane®, within the last six months
- Use of topical over the counter or prescription retinoids such as Retinol creams, gels, Tazarotene, Tretinoin, Adapalene, within the last 30 days
- Active acne or rosacea
- Active localized or systemic infection, or an open wound or abscess in area being treated
- Significant systemic inflammatory disease or illness, such as lupus, or an illness localized in area being treated
- Common acquired nevi that are predisposed to the development of malignant melanoma
- Current or prior herpes simplex in the target treatment area
- Is receiving or has received gold therapy
- Currently enrolled in an investigational drug or device trial, or has received an investigational drug or was treated with an investigational device within in the area to be treated 6 months prior to study entry
- Facial cosmetic procedures in the target areas within previous 6 months (e.g., laser or other energy-based device treatment, microdermabrasion, injection of dermal filler)
- Micro-needling and/or chemical peel on the target treatment area in the past 3 months
- Injection of cosmetic neurotoxins such as botulinum toxin in the treatment areas within the previous 3 months of standard duration toxins, and 6 months for long lasting neurotoxin therapy
- Significant uncontrolled concurrent illness, such as diabetes mellitus, hypertension, or cardiovascular disease
- History of immunosuppression/immune deficiency disorder or currently using immunosuppressive medications
- Planned weight loss of greater than five pounds
- Facial hair in the treatment areas which would prevent evaluation of the outcome measures. For men, must be clean shaven in the area of treatment
- Any condition or situation which, in the investigators opinion, may put the subject at significant risk, may confound study results or may interfere significantly with the subject's participation
- Is pregnant or of childbearing potential and not using medically effective birth control, or has been pregnant in the last 3 months, is currently breast feeding or planning a pregnancy during the study.
- Has had unprotected sun exposure within four weeks of treatment, including the use of tanning beds or plans for unprotected sun exposure during the course of the study,
- Has used tanning products, such as creams, lotions and sprays within four weeks prior to treatment.
- Coagulation disorder or currently using anti-platelet/anticoagulation medication, including use of aspirin, or fish oil supplements
- Taking medications that alter the wound-healing response or evidence of compromised wound healing
- Known history of keloid formation
- Known history of medical diseases that may cause koebnerization (the appearance of disease in another location), such as vitiligo, psoriasis or lichen planus
- History of skin cancer or suspicious lesions in treatment area
- Subject is relocating out of the zone of the study site (ie. Moving out of state or about 50+ miles away from study area)
- Subject has history or active melasma or other pigmentary disorders such as vitiligo.

What is the study measuring?
Primary Outcome Measures
Outcome Measure |
Measure Description |
Time Frame |
|---|---|---|
|
ECCA (échelle d'évaluation clinique des cicatrices d'acné) Grading
Time Frame: 3 months after the final treatment, Optional 6 months after final treatment
|
A 1 point or greater reduction in facial acne scars severity using the Echelle d'Evaluation Clinique des Cicatrices d'Acne (ECCA) Score ECCA Global Score Limits: Lowest Score (0) to Highest Score (540) |
3 months after the final treatment, Optional 6 months after final treatment
|
Secondary Outcome Measures
Outcome Measure |
Measure Description |
Time Frame |
|---|---|---|
|
Blinded Evaluation of Treatment Imaging
Time Frame: From enrollment up to3 months after the final treatment, Optional up to 6 months after final treatment
|
Panel of independent expert grader dermatologists will review randomized photo sets of pre- and post-treatment imaging and asked to identify the post-treatment image.
|
From enrollment up to3 months after the final treatment, Optional up to 6 months after final treatment
|
|
Physician Global Aesthetic Improvement Scale Scoring
Time Frame: Up to 3 months after the final treatment, Optional up to 6 months after final treatment
|
Primary physician for the investigative site will review post-treatment imaging and score the improvement seen in the photos based on the below scale. 5 - Much Improved 4 - Improved 3 - No Change 2 - Worse 1 - Much Worse |
Up to 3 months after the final treatment, Optional up to 6 months after final treatment
|
|
Treatment Pain Assessment
Time Frame: Through study completion, an average of 12 months
|
Treatment Pain will be assessed at all treatment visits on a standard Visual Analog Scale Ranging from a score of 0 (no pain) to 10 (maximum possible pain)
|
Through study completion, an average of 12 months
